Common Kitchen Floor Renovation Jobs
Kitchen floor replacement - involves removing old flooring and installing a new surface to enhance durability and style.
Tile flooring renovation - updates existing tile with new grout, repair, or complete replacement for a refreshed look.
Laminate or vinyl flooring upgrades - installs modern, easy-to-maintain materials that mimic natural surfaces.
Concrete floor refinishing - resurfaces and seals concrete to improve appearance and prevent damage.
Wood floor restoration - repairs scratches, replaces damaged planks, and refines the finish for a polished look.
Floor leveling and subfloor repair - ensures a smooth, stable surface for new flooring installation.
Kitchen Floor Renovation Questions
What types of flooring materials are suitable for kitchen renovations? Popular options include ceramic tile, vinyl, hardwood, and laminate, each offering different styles and durability levels for kitchen use.
Can existing kitchen floors be resurfaced instead of replaced? Yes, surface refinishing or overlay techniques can often refresh the appearance without a full removal, depending on the condition of the current flooring.
What should property owners consider when choosing a kitchen floor renovation style? Factors include durability, maintenance requirements, aesthetic preferences, and compatibility with existing kitchen features.
Are there options for upgrading flooring to improve safety and slip resistance? Yes, selecting textured or slip-resistant finishes and materials can enhance safety in the kitchen environment.
